The Rolex Day-Date 36: A Legacy of Excellence
The Rolex Day-Date 36, a member of the prestigious Day-Date family, is a watch that commands attention. Its 36mm case, while seemingly modest in size compared to some modern trends, perfectly embodies the classic elegance that defines the collection. It’s a size that sits comfortably on a wide range of wrists, making it a versatile choice for both men and women who appreciate timeless style. The smaller size, compared to its larger sibling the Day-Date 40, also contributes to its refined and sophisticated aesthetic.
This watch isn't just about its size; it’s about the materials, the movements, and the overall experience of owning a piece of horological history. The use of precious metals, primarily 18ct gold in various forms – yellow, white, and Everose – underscores the luxurious nature of the DD36. The warm glow of the yellow gold, the cool brilliance of the white gold, and the rose-gold hue of Everose each offer a unique aesthetic appeal, allowing wearers to choose a metal that best complements their personal style and preferences. The weight and feel of the 18ct gold further enhance the luxurious experience, solidifying its position as a high-end timepiece.
